Fleet sales may not be the best, but factory utilization is often ignored. The Alpha based cars are not selling that well. Sure, the Camaro has fewer fleet sales, but you have to wonder how that comes into play. The overhead of the factory is the same, whether you sell 5 cars or 5000. Not to mention cost of components generally go down the more you buy. The Camaro may make more money per sale, but the lower utilization and volume may eat into that.

The fact is we don’t know what the end result is. The Challengers may be printing money for Dodge while Camaro is bleeding GM dry. It could be the reverse. The only people that know the answer aren’t talking to us about it.
